In strong acids, an orange solution of barium dichromate is formed: 2BaCrO 4 (s) + 2H + (aq) <==> 2Ba 2+ (aq) + Cr 2 O 7 2- (aq) + H 2 O (l) Barium chromate is insoluble in bases. Barium chromate is soluble in mineral acids, but only slightly soluble in acetic acid. For example, when we mix aqueous potassium chromate with aqueous barium nitrate, a reaction occurs to form a precipitate (BaCr04) and dissolved potassium nitrate. It is very insoluble in water, but is soluble in acids : 2 BaCrO4 + 2 H+ 2 Ba2+ + Cr2O72 + H2O Ksp = [Ba 2+ ] [CrO 42] = 2.1 10 10 It can react with barium hydroxide in the presence of sodium azide to create barium chromate (V). The yellow color originates from $\ce{CrO4^{2-}}$, and a small amount of finely divided precipitate may look white at first sight (namely when the yellow color of the solution is more intense), when it is actually pale-yellow (it can look like this). Barium Chromate - Preparation Method potassium dichromate was dissolved in water and heated, sodium carbonate was added, filtered, and a solution of acetic acid and barium chloride was added until a precipitate of barium chromate occurred.
